Serangoon Garden Market: Best Satay & Mee Soto in Singapore
I have tried the satay at Glutton’s Bay, the East Coast Market, Lau Pa Sat and at many other places, but I think the one at Serangoon Garden Market beats them all. This stall used to be the famous one … Continue reading
